Form 4: C3.ai Director Granted 32,309 Stock Options

Sentiment:

Insider Transaction Report


C3.ai, Inc. director Michael G. McCaffery was granted 32,309 stock options with an exercise price of $19.16.

Summary

  • Michael G. McCaffery, a Director of C3.ai, Inc. (AI), was granted 32,309 stock options.
  • The options have an exercise price of $19.16 per share.
  • The grant date for these options was October 3, 2025, which also serves as the Vesting Commencement Date.
  • The options are scheduled to expire on October 2, 2035.
  • Vesting occurs at 12.5% of the shares on the last day of each fiscal quarter for two years, contingent on the reporting person remaining a director and attending regularly scheduled board meetings in person.
  • If the director fails to attend a meeting, vesting for that quarter's shares is suspended, but these suspended shares may vest after the two-year anniversary if attendance requirements are met in subsequent periods.
